A New Approach on Design of a Digital Phase-Locked Loop
TL;DR: This letter proposes a new approach to the design of a digital phase-locked loop with a finite impulse response (FIR) structure, deadbeat property, and H∞ performance that has intrinsic robustness against quantization effects because of the FIR structure.

Power scheduling optimization under single-valued neutrosophic uncertainty
TL;DR: This paper investigates a single-valued neutrosophic optimization method to deal with system uncertainty, which provides a more cost-effective solution to decrease the electricity utility charge and satisfy the daily output production requirements.
